The mechanical effect of monitoring and controlling the impregnation in the resin infusion process

Abstract: Nowadays, most of industries are optimizing their processes to make their products more competitive. In the composites manufacturing industry, there is a big gap between the almost fully automated processes and those which require an intensive labor‐work. Although it has many advantages, the resin infusion process is characterized for its lack of automation.
